Fabric Choice for Stamped Needlework
The option of textile is essential in any type of needlework project, and stamped embroidery is no exemption. The material acts as the canvas for your layout, and the type you pick can influence the general look and feel of your task. Common selections consist of cotton, linen, and polyester blends, each bringing unique top qualities. Cotton is popular for its soft feel and ease of sewing, while bed linen adds a rustic appeal to styles, especially for vintage patterns. Whichever textile you select, ensure it is firmly woven to sustain intricate stitches and stand up gradually.
Needles and Thread
Needles are critical for stamped embroidery, with dimensions and kinds that can differ depending upon the textile and string used. Needlework needles typically come with a larger eye than typical sewing needles to suit thicker strings. Selecting a needle that is appropriate for your textile’s thickness and the design’s detail is vital, as a needle that is also thick might damage fragile textiles. A needle organizer can likewise be useful to keep different needle sizes in order and easily available.
Needlework thread is just as essential as the needle. High-quality thread makes a difference in the appearance and sturdiness of your work. Cotton needlework floss is one of the most frequently used, as it is very easy to work with and offers a dynamic coating. Silk and metal strings can also be utilized to include appearance and luster. Choose colors that complement the printed style on your material and match the style you’re going for, whether it be vivid and spirited or soft and soft.
Hoops and Frames
An embroidery hoop or structure is necessary for holding your fabric tight while you work. Hoops are generally made from timber or plastic, with a screw-tightening device that assists maintain the material protected. Frameworks, on the other hand, offer an even more rigid alternative and are optimal for bigger or extra complicated designs. The ideal hoop size relies on your job; smaller hoops enable more control over information, while bigger hoops can cover bigger areas of material. Selecting a hoop that fits your hand easily will make long hours of sewing much more enjoyable.
Scissors and Trimming Tools
Sharp scissors are a must-have for any type of embroidery job. Embroidery scissors are small, with sharp, pointed pointers that make it very easy to cut strings close to the textile without causing frays. For a stamped embroidery project, having both a set of embroidery scissors and bigger material scissors can be useful. Some embroiderers likewise utilize thread snips, which are developed for fast and exact cuts. Keeping your scissors in good condition by utilizing them only for thread and material will certainly make sure clean cuts and protect against monotony.
Thread Organizer and Storage Space
With the variety of shades and structures that can go into a stamped embroidery project, a thread coordinator is a very useful tool. Organizers help prevent tangling and permit you to promptly locate the shades you require. Floss bobbins, either plastic or cardboard, are typically utilized to wrap string, while a storage space box can keep everything in one location. Organizing your string by color or shade is specifically useful for jobs with several shades and can quicken your workflow.
Marking Devices
While stamped embroidery styles are pre-printed on the material, marking devices can still come in useful. Water-soluble or air-erasable pens are suitable for noting modifications or keeping in mind information on the textile. Dressmaker’s chalk is an additional alternative for short-term markings, specifically helpful for adding tailored aspects or small notes to improve the design. Simply keep in mind to check any kind of marking device on a little area of textile initially to ensure it can be conveniently gotten rid of once the project is finished.
Lighting and Zoom
Excellent lighting is important for accuracy in embroidery, especially when dealing with intricate patterns and fragile materials. All-natural light is typically suitable, yet a devoted craft lamp can work equally as well, specifically if it has flexible brightness levels. Zoom devices, such as multiplying lights or clip-on magnifiers, can also be valuable, specifically for those servicing in-depth styles or little stitches. Buying proper illumination and magnifying will help in reducing eye pressure and improve the accuracy of your stitches.
Ending up Devices
Once your stamped embroidery item is total, finishing tools can aid you present it perfectly. An iron and ironing board are essential to eliminate any type of folds and established the stitches. A pressing fabric can aid secure fragile materials and keep strings from getting damaged during ironing. Furthermore, framing tools like floor covering boards and adhesive tapes can be made use of to protect your embroidery in a structure or hoop for screen. Ending up touches like these not only enhance the look yet also aid preserve your job.
